AI cloud services provider Nebius Group N.V. has announced it will release its second-quarter financial results for fiscal 2026 before the US market opens on Wednesday, August 12.
Company management is scheduled to host a conference call at 8:00 AM Eastern Time on the same day to discuss the performance and field questions from participants. Registration links for the live webcast and replay will be made available on the company's investor relations website.
Nebius Group, headquartered in Amsterdam, Netherlands, is an AI infrastructure company focused on building a complete technology platform for developers and enterprises, spanning from data training to production deployment. The company's portfolio also includes Avride, a developer of autonomous driving and delivery robots, and TripleTen, a tech education platform. Additionally, it holds equity stakes in companies such as ClickHouse and Toloka.
This earnings release comes at a time of rapid business expansion for the firm. Nebius has recently announced several major partnerships: Nvidia committed to acquiring a 9.3% stake in the company for $2 billion and establishing a formal AI infrastructure collaboration; Meta signed a computing capacity procurement agreement potentially worth up to $27 billion over a five-year term.

The company delivered strong results in the prior quarter (Q1 FY2026): group revenue surged 684% year-over-year to $399 million. Core AI cloud business revenue alone reached $390 million, an 841% increase compared to the same period last year. At that time, the company reaffirmed its full-year guidance, projecting group revenue to be between $3.0 billion and $3.4 billion.
